【发布时间】:2021-07-01 12:44:10
【问题描述】:
我昨天学习了如何使用 java 在 eclipse 上实现和使用 sikuli 来进行自动化测试。 在第一次尝试运行代码时,我得到了这个错误 -
[错误] RunTimeINIT: *** 注意:在 Java 8+ 上运行 *** 请报告问题 ***
接着是-
线程“main”中的异常 java.lang.RuntimeException: ImageMissing: C:\sekuli\sekuli.png
The code I currently use and the full errors
package sekuli;
import java.util.concurrent.TimeUnit;
import java.util.regex.Pattern;
import org.openqa.selenium.WebDriver;
import org.openqa.selenium.chrome.ChromeDriver;
import org.sikuli.script.FindFailed;
import org.sikuli.script.Screen;
import com.tigervnc.rfb.screenTypes;
public class EX1 {
public static void main(String[] args) throws FindFailed, InterruptedException {
System.setProperty("webdriver.chrome.driver","C:\\Users\\נייד\\Desktop\\Tools\\Selenium\\chromedriver.exe");
WebDriver driver = new ChromeDriver();
driver.get("https://www.jobmaster.co.il/");
Screen scn = new Screen();
scn.click("C:\\sekuli\\sekuli.png");
}
}
我已将 sikuli 1.1.3 版 jar 导入 Eclipse。 我尝试将图片移动到不同的目录(尽管我相信“丢失文件”错误源于最初的“RunTimeINIT”错误) 我使用的是运行 windows 8.1 的 64 位系统并安装了 Java 8。
我可以提供更多细节来帮助你们帮助我吗?
【问题讨论】: